Associate Professor Julia Lynch

BAgrSc (UQ), Grad Dip Ec (UNE), MEc (UNE)

Head of School, Business
Bathurst
Building 1411 Room 220

Julia is a lecturer in economics and finance. She lectures in Microeconomics, Financial Institutions and Markets and Treasury Risk Management. Her previous experience includes working for both State and Commonwealth governments as a research and policy economist. Julia's is currently undertaking a PhD on competitiveness in the Australian banking sector.
